The 'Warren Zevon: Join Me in L.A.' tribute concert at L.A.'s United Theater featured a star-studded lineup, including Jackson Browne, Dwight Yoakam, and Fountains of Wayne.

The concert showcased over 30 songs and featured more than 50 musicians, lasting nearly four hours. Despite its lengthy duration, the tribute still felt incomplete, leaving the audience greedy for more of Zevon's iconic songs.

It says that some of us are just a little too greedy, 22 years after the honoree’s death, to hear as many of the rock genius’s greatest songs performed as possible, even if that really would entail playing it all night long.

The Wild Honey organization successfully put on a comprehensive tribute, highlighting Zevon's catalog of witty humor and warmth.
